What's the biggest size dumpster accessible?

The biggest roll-off dumpster that businesses usually rent is a 40 yard container. This gigantic d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is comparable to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.

The weight limitation on 40 yard containers usually 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be really mindful of this limitation and do your best not to surpass it. If you do go over the limit, you can incur overage costs, which add up quickly.

Examples of jobs that a 40 yard container will probably be the ideal size for include: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-dwelling interior renovation Getting rid of rubbish when you're moving in or out House demolition New house construction Commercial and residential cleanouts


How high can I fill my dumpster?

You can fill your dumpster as full as you like, so long as you don't load it higher compared to the sides of the container. Over-filling the dumpster could cause the waste or debris to slide off as the dumpster is loaded onto the truck or as the truck is driving. Overloaded or overweight dumpsters are just not safe, and businesses will not carry unsafe loads in order to protect drivers and passengers on the road.

In certain regions, dumpster loads must be tarped for safety. If your load is too high, it will not have the ability to be tarped so you'll need to remove some of the debris before it can be hauled away. This may lead to additional costs if it requires you to keep the dumpster for a longer period of time. Remember to maintain your load no higher compared to the sides of the dumpster, and you will be fine.

What Types of Debris Can I Place Into a Dumpster?

It's possible for you to put most kinds of debris into a trash container rental in Grandfield. There are, however,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ot place substances into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ronic Equipment and batteries are also prohibited. If something introduces an environmental danger, you likely cannot place it in a dumpster. Contact your rental company if you're unsure.

That makes most kinds of debris you could place in the dumpster, comprise dr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Pretty much any sort of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.

Certain kinds of acceptable debris, however, may require additional fees. If you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you should ask the rental company whether you need to pay another f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, determined by the thing.


Front-load vs Rolloff Dumpsters

Front -load and roll off dumpsters have distinct designs which make them useful in various manners. Understanding more about them will help you choose an option that's right for your endeavor.

Front-load Dumpsters

Front-load dumpsters have mechanical arms that may lift heavy items. This really is a handy choice for jobs that include a lot of heavy things like appliances and concrete. They're also great for emptying commercial dumpsters like the kind restaurants use.

Rolloff Dumpsters

Rolloff dumpsters are typically the right choice for commercial and residential jobs like fixing a roof, remodeling a cellar, or including a room to your home. They've doors that swing open, letting you walk into the dumpster. They also have open tops that let you throw debris into the container. Rental firms will commonly leave a roll off dumpster at your endeavor place for many days or weeks. This really is a handy choice for both small and big jobs.

What Size Dumpster Do I Need for a Roofing Project?

Picking a dumpster size requires some educated guesswork. It is often difficult for individuals to estimate the sizes that they need for roofing projects because, realistically, they do not know just how much stuff their roofs feature.

There are, however, some basic guidelines you'll be able to follow to make a good choice. If you're removing a commercial roof, then you'll most likely require a dumpster that provides you at least 40 square yards.

If you're working on residential roofing job, then you can ordinarily rely on a smaller size. You can usually exp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will probably desire a 20-yard dumpster.

A lot of people order one size bigger than they think their endeavors will take since they wish to prevent the additional expense and hassle of replacing complete dumpsters that weren't large enough.

Dumpster Rental in Grandfield Costs: Flat Rate vs Per Ton

If you are looking to rent a dumpster in Grandfield, one of your main concerns is going to be price. There are generally two pricing options available when renting a dumpster in Grandfield. Flat rate is pricing determined by the size of the dumpster, not the quantity of material you place in it. Per ton pricing will bill you based on the weight you need hauled.

One kind of pricing structure is not always more expensive than the other. Knowing just how much material you have to throw away, you might get a better deal with per short ton pricing. On the other hand, flat rate pricing is able to help you keep a limit on prices when you are dealing with unknown weights.
